Recently, a leading beverage company has launched a recall of a product in the United Kingdom owing to worries about increased chemical levels in some of its drink batches. The recall focuses on 300ml can multipacks of a favored sugar-free drink, with best-before dates set for 31 October and 30 November 2023. The corporation has reassured customers that most of its items, including regular cans and all glass and plastic bottles available in the UK, remain unaffected by this recall.
Recall Information
The recall was triggered due to the discovery of chemical levels exceeding acceptable limits in specific batches. Although the company has not revealed the precise nature of the chemical, it stressed that the recall is a precautionary step to protect consumer health. The impacted items are confined to the indicated multipacks of 300ml cans, with no other product lines or packaging types being affected.
Guidance for Consumers
Consumers who have bought the impacted multipacks are urged not to drink the beverages. They should reach out to the company’s customer service for instructions on returning the products and receiving a refund or replacement. The company has set up a special helpline and email support to help consumers with the recall procedure. Retailers have been directed to take the affected products off their shelves to stop further sales.

Regulatory Oversight
The recall is being conducted in coordination with the UK’s Food Standards Agency (FSA), which is monitoring the situation to ensure that all necessary actions are taken to protect public health. The FSA has issued an alert to inform consumers about the recall and is working closely with the company to oversee the effectiveness of the recall process. The agency has also advised consumers to follow the company’s guidance regarding the return or disposal of the affected products.
